

Users who prefer the keyboard can use the Command Palette using the keyboard only. You may browse the available selection of commands or type to filter available commands and options. Open the Command Palette via Menu > View > Command Palette, or by using the keyboard shortcut Ctrl-K. It may be used to open recently opened PDF documents quickly, to switch between tabs, and to invoke any of the available commands that Sumatra supports. The key variable accepts single keys and key combinations, e.g., Alt-I or q. The Cmd parameter accepts any of the supported commands, e.g., CmdBookView, which you find listed here on this page. For each, Cmd and Key variables need to be set. The Shortcuts section of the file handles custom keyboard shortcuts. Sumatra 3.4 introduces support for custom keyboard shortcuts and for the remapping of existing keyboard shortcuts this is done using the configuration file as well under Settings > Advanced Settings.
